public class EscapingCompactWriter
extends com.thoughtworks.xstream.io.xml.CompactWriter
CompactWriter that enables setting on/off XML escaping.| Modifier and Type | Field and Description |
|---|---|
protected boolean |
escapeXml |
| Constructor and Description |
|---|
EscapingCompactWriter(Writer writer) |
EscapingCompactWriter(Writer writer,
int mode) |
EscapingCompactWriter(Writer writer,
int mode,
com.thoughtworks.xstream.io.naming.NameCoder nameCoder) |
EscapingCompactWriter(Writer writer,
com.thoughtworks.xstream.io.naming.NameCoder nameCoder) |
| Modifier and Type | Method and Description |
|---|---|
void |
setEscapeXml(boolean escapeXml) |
protected void |
writeAttributeValue(com.thoughtworks.xstream.core.util.QuickWriter writer,
String text) |
protected void |
writeText(com.thoughtworks.xstream.core.util.QuickWriter writer,
String text) |
addAttribute, close, endNode, flush, getNewLine, setValue, startNode, startNodepublic EscapingCompactWriter(Writer writer)
public EscapingCompactWriter(Writer writer, int mode)
public EscapingCompactWriter(Writer writer, com.thoughtworks.xstream.io.naming.NameCoder nameCoder)
public EscapingCompactWriter(Writer writer, int mode, com.thoughtworks.xstream.io.naming.NameCoder nameCoder)
public void setEscapeXml(boolean escapeXml)
protected void writeText(com.thoughtworks.xstream.core.util.QuickWriter writer,
String text)
writeText in class com.thoughtworks.xstream.io.xml.PrettyPrintWriterprotected void writeAttributeValue(com.thoughtworks.xstream.core.util.QuickWriter writer,
String text)
writeAttributeValue in class com.thoughtworks.xstream.io.xml.PrettyPrintWriterCopyright © 2018 CrafterCMS. All rights reserved.